Essential Considerations for Commissioning Fine Woodwork

Engaging the services of specialized woodworkers requires careful planning and consideration to ensure the final product aligns with expectations and budgetary constraints. The following tips provide guidance through the process.

Tip 1: Define Project Scope and Objectives: Clearly articulate the purpose, dimensions, design preferences, and functional requirements of the desired woodwork. This detailed specification serves as the foundation for accurate quotes and minimizes potential misunderstandings.

Tip 2: Research and Vet Potential Providers: Investigate the experience, reputation, and portfolio of prospective woodworkers. Request references and examine examples of past projects to assess their craftsmanship and design capabilities.

Tip 3: Prioritize Material Selection: Different wood species offer varying levels of durability, aesthetics, and cost. Consider the intended use of the woodwork, the desired appearance, and the budget when selecting materials. Discuss the pros and cons of various options with the woodworker.

Tip 4: Obtain Detailed Quotes: Request comprehensive, itemized quotes from multiple providers that outline material costs, labor charges, and any additional fees. Compare the quotes carefully to ensure they reflect the same project scope and quality of materials.

Tip 5: Clarify Design Details and Modifications: Establish a clear understanding of the design details, including dimensions, hardware, finishes, and any custom elements. Discuss the process for making modifications during the project and the potential impact on cost and timelines.

Tip 6: Establish a Payment Schedule: Agree upon a clear payment schedule with the woodworker that outlines the deposit amount, milestone payments, and final payment terms. This ensures both parties are protected throughout the project.

Tip 7: Secure a Written Contract: Formalize the agreement with a written contract that specifies the project scope, timeline, payment terms, material specifications, and warranty information. This document provides legal protection in case of disputes.

These guidelines aim to facilitate a seamless collaboration between clients and woodworkers, resulting in high-quality, bespoke wood products that enhance the value and aesthetic appeal of homes and businesses. Meticulous planning and open communication are key.

3. Quality Materials

3. Quality Materials, Custom

The selection and utilization of quality materials are fundamentally intertwined with specialized woodwork in northern Virginia. The longevity, aesthetic appeal, and structural integrity of custom-built pieces depend heavily on the characteristics of the chosen wood and associated components. The specific environmental conditions of the Mid-Atlantic region further necessitate careful consideration of material suitability and durability.

  • Hardwood Selection and Sourcing

    The choice of hardwood species directly impacts the aesthetic appearance, strength, and resistance to wear and tear of the finished product. Locally sourced hardwoods, when available, offer the benefit of acclimatization to the regional climate, minimizing potential issues with warping or cracking. The selection of cherry, walnut, maple, or oak is frequently observed based on grain patterns, color variations, and density characteristics. Ethical sourcing practices further contribute to the sustainability of the industry and the preservation of local forests.

  • Joinery and Adhesives

    The quality of joinery techniques and adhesives plays a critical role in the structural integrity of wooden constructions. Mortise and tenon joints, dovetail joints, and other traditional methods, when executed with precision, ensure long-term stability. High-quality adhesives that exhibit strong bonding properties and resistance to moisture are essential for preventing joint failure. A poorly executed joint or an inadequate adhesive can lead to premature deterioration, compromising the overall value of the piece.

  • Finishes and Protective Coatings

    The application of appropriate finishes and protective coatings enhances the aesthetic appeal of the wood while safeguarding it against environmental factors such as moisture, UV radiation, and abrasion. High-quality finishes provide a durable and attractive surface that resists staining, scratching, and fading. The selection of environmentally friendly, low-VOC (volatile organic compound) finishes further contributes to indoor air quality and minimizes potential health risks. Shellac, varnish, lacquer, and oil-based finishes represent common options with varying degrees of protection and aesthetic characteristics.

  • Hardware and Accessories

    The incorporation of high-quality hardware and accessories, such as hinges, drawer slides, and knobs, enhances the functionality and durability of wooden furniture and cabinetry. Solid brass, stainless steel, or other corrosion-resistant materials are often preferred for their longevity and aesthetic appeal. Poorly manufactured hardware can detract from the overall quality of the piece and may require frequent replacement. The careful selection of hardware that complements the design aesthetic and functional requirements is a crucial aspect of custom woodwork.

Frequently Asked Questions about Custom Woodworking in Northern Virginia

This section addresses common inquiries regarding the process, benefits, and considerations associated with commissioning bespoke woodworking projects within the northern Virginia region.

Question 1: What distinguishes custom woodworking from standard carpentry services?

Custom woodworking focuses on creating unique, high-end pieces tailored to specific client requirements. It typically involves intricate designs, specialized joinery techniques, and the use of premium materials. Standard carpentry services often address more general construction and repair needs, utilizing standardized materials and methods.

Question 2: How does one initiate a custom woodworking project?

The initial step involves clearly defining the project scope, desired aesthetic, and functional requirements. Gathering reference images and sketches is beneficial. Subsequently, researching and contacting local woodworkers with relevant experience and expertise is advised to discuss project feasibility and obtain quotes.

Question 3: What factors influence the cost of custom woodworking?

The primary factors influencing cost include the complexity of the design, the type and quantity of materials used, the labor hours required, and the experience level of the woodworker. Intricate carvings, exotic hardwoods, and elaborate finishes typically increase the overall project expense.

Question 4: How long does a custom woodworking project typically take?

Project duration varies significantly depending on the scale and complexity of the project. Small projects, such as a single piece of furniture, may take several weeks. Larger projects, such as custom kitchen cabinetry, can span several months. A detailed project timeline should be established during the initial consultation with the woodworker.

Question 5: What are the maintenance requirements for custom wood furniture?

Maintenance requirements vary depending on the type of wood, finish, and intended use. Regular dusting and occasional cleaning with a mild, wood-specific cleaner are generally recommended. Avoid placing wood furniture in direct sunlight or exposing it to extreme temperature fluctuations. Consider applying a protective wax or polish periodically to maintain the finish and prevent moisture damage.

Question 6: How does one ensure the quality and longevity of a custom woodworking project?

Selecting a reputable woodworker with a proven track record is crucial. Reviewing their portfolio, requesting references, and examining examples of their craftsmanship provides valuable insights. A detailed contract outlining material specifications, construction methods, and warranty information offers added assurance. Routine maintenance and care further contribute to the longevity of the piece.
